Amplification of Soybean Mosaic Virus Coat Protein Gene by Polymerase Chain Reaction and Its Sequence Analysis

Chu Rui-yin, Leng Xiao-hong, Bao Yi-ming, Pu Zu-qin,Pan Nai-sui and Chen Zhang-liang   

Abstract: The results of cloning and sequencing of the gene encoding coat protein (CP) of soybean mosaic virus with PCR technique are reported. The virus RNA was extracted from purified viral particles. The first strand of cDNA was synthesized from viral RNA template primed with synthetic 3′polymerase chain reaction (PCR) primer using AMV reverse transcriptase. A DNA fragment with 0.8 kb was obtained after 30 PCR amplification cycles. The restriction map of the DNA fragment has been analyzed and its whole DNA sequence has been determined. The results show that the entire gene encoding the coat protein of soybean mosaic virus (SMV) has been cloned. The homologies of the DNA sequences and the deduced amino acid sequence between the SMV Sa strain shown here and the N strain of SMV published abroad are 96% and 96.6% respectively. The work of tranferring the CP gene into soybean to obtain transgenic soybean plants that resist to SMV infection is in progress.
